Apple 'Bramley's Seedling' Tree - Supplied In A 10 Litre Pot At Approx 150-170cm

Apple 'Bramley's Seedling' is the most famous of all cooking apples. This tree originated in Nottinghamshire in the UK in the early 19th century and has gone on to become the number 1 cooking apple available. Bramley is a large vigorous tree that produces huge crops of very large green apples sometimes stripped with red. The flesh is firm, juicy, very acidic, with a strong apple flavour, making it perfect for cooking. The apples have excellent keeping qualities. Bramley's Seedling is Tripold - meaning that it requires two pollination partners, if all three are to produce fruit.

  • Site: Fairly Sheltered
  • Soil: Well Drained
  • Position: Full Sun
  • Harvest: October
  • Hardiness: Hardy
  • Uses: Cooking, Juicing And Common In Cider Production
  • Pollination Group: Triploid (Meaning It Needs 2 Pollinatiion Partners) Group 3 (Will Pollinate With Groups 2/3/4)
